January 31, 1938 - August 5, 2000 Some people stay in our lives awhile, some leave footprints on our hearts, and we are never ever the same. Dr. Brenda Reilly was the Associate Athletic Director at Central
Connecticut State University from 1971 - 1996. She served as an instructor of physical education at CCSU while also coaching women's basketball, volleyball, and softball. After receiving her bachelor's degree in
Physical Education from California State University at Los Angeles in 1969 she served as a graduate assistant, women's basketball coach and taught Physical Education courses. She earned her masters degree in Physical
Education from UCLA in 1970. From 1970-71 she was the women's basketball coach and physical education instructor at Western Connecticut State University. In 1981 she received her Doctorate of Physical Education from
Springfield College. It is difficult to recount the records, the achievements, and the honors that Dr. Brenda Reilly received during her life. But that is not the measure of this extraordinary woman.
The commitment she demonstrated to her work, family and friends is what separated Dr. Reilly from ordinary to extraordinary. And last but not least was her wonderful sense of humor! In March of 2000
the Women's Basketball Coaches Association (WBCA) named Brenda Reilly as the winner of its 2000 Jostens-Berenson Service Award, recognizing her lifelong commitment of service to the game of women's basketball. Her
tireless dedication to not only women's basketball, but to women's athletics is second to none. Brenda was one of the Founding members of the Connecticut Women's Basketball Hall of Fame and always recognized the
